Meet our Guide of the Week: Jeffrey!

Jeffrey is a Vayable Ambassador and urban explorer that loves all things food. He publishes a food blog and writes restaurant critiques in New York Magazine’s Grub Street. He believes that food is the greatest medium to communicate and connect. On Vayable, he offers a Queens Midnight Street Crawl and Queens Tastes of the World. We sat down with him and asked […]

Guide of the Week: Midtown Food Cart Tour with Brian

A couple weeks ago, we had the pleasure of going along on the Midtown Food Cart tour, led by our guides at Urban Oyster. The experience went beyond just any food tasting tour. We got to meet the chefs, learn about the regulatory history of food carts, and taste some delicious food! Our guide was Brian, a […]
